Folks need to pay closer attention to housing reclamation struggles. That area of the work is going to explode next year out of necessity. It will be a major site of struggle against neoliberal governance and monied players who are profiting from our suffering right now.
Everyone should have a friend who knows how to change locks btw. If you don't, you may want to work on that this winter.
We are going to need to be more invested in each other than in this system on a level that most people haven't envisioned before, let alone experienced. Neoliberalism is not Trumpism, but it will displace and dispose of people en masse in its own ways unless we fight.
Some people who are not going to be evicted from their homes, whose needs will be met, will call us ungrateful for rejecting Democratic crumbs. They will say we are ungrateful, as tho we have them to thank for delivering us from Trump, as opposed to ourselves, who did the voting.
Fighting mass displacement is going to be hugely important in this era of collapse. Mass displacement, as a form of structural maintenance (sustaining capitalism, for example), leads to mass disposal. It's a matter of what shape that disposal takes.
Be ready to defend land and housing.
